The Growth Hormone Releasing Peptide, in Plain Words

You might be curious about growth hormone and its role in the body. As we age, our natural production of growth hormone tends to decrease. This decline can manifest as reduced muscle mass, increased body fat, poorer sleep quality, and slower healing times. Sermorelin acetate is a synthetic peptide that mimics a naturally occurring hormone called Growth Hormone-Releasing Hormone (GHRH). It works by stimulating your own pituitary gland to release more growth hormone in a pulsatile manner, similar to how it functions in younger individuals.

This GHRH analog acts directly on the pituitary gland. It encourages the release of endogenous growth hormone without directly administering growth hormone itself. This approach aims to restore more youthful hormone levels. The therapy works by signaling the pituitary to increase its output. This is a key distinction from other hormone replacement strategies and supports a more natural bodily response.

Is Sermorelin FDA Approved?

Compounded sermorelin acetate is not FDA approved as a standalone drug. It is compounded by licensed pharmacies under specific regulatory frameworks, sections 503A and 503B of the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act. This allows for the preparation of customized medications for individual patients when a physician deems it medically necessary.

What is the difference between Sermorelin and HGH?

Sermorelin acetate is a GHRH analog that stimulates your own pituitary gland to produce and release its own growth hormone. Human Growth Hormone (HGH) therapy involves directly administering synthetic HGH. The sermorelin protocol aims to work with your body’s natural system, promoting a more physiological pulsatile release of growth hormone, unlike the constant levels sometimes seen with direct HGH administration. This difference can contribute to fewer side effects and a more natural physiological response.
